Output 99fad5343cd1e779c36839942a25e3d5e89a43e0aaf51ddd11b7d8765ab35029:0

value
33606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8930878cfa5e0fd6c196e446806dee2daf0519e4 OP_EQUAL
address
3ECQdiJasxVdKL38ToHXisEBKt5qodujd7
transaction
99fad5343cd1e779c36839942a25e3d5e89a43e0aaf51ddd11b7d8765ab35029